The 2024 Lagos International Polo Tournament otherwise known as 2024 NPA/ GTCO Lagos International Polo Tournament, will expectedly gallop off on a blistering note today with a record 39 teams jostling for top honours in the 120th edition of the glamorous competition.
Many ambitious teams which are fully armed with foreign professionals and fortified with thoroughbred Argentine horses, will be competing for honours in the four major cups categories namely The Open Cup, The Majekodunmi Cup, The Lagos Low Cup and the Silver Cup.
For the first time , the tournament will be decided over four weeks of high octane polo actions between January 23 and 28 with five equally-matched teams jostling for the Open Cup glory.
President Lagos Polo Club, Bode Makanjuola, disclosed at a press conference in Lagos yesterday that the club has put everything in place to make the 120th anniversary edition of the most prestigious polo tournament in Africa truly special.

According to the Polo Captain, Muyiwa Oni, the highly revered Majekodunmi Cup will take the centre stage between January 30th and February 4th with four teams from Lagos and Abuja battling for the top prize while the third week holding between February 6 and 11 will feature 16 teams drawn from major polo centers across the country locked in battle royale for the Low Cup.
The grand finale that would draw the curtain on the 120th edition of the annual fiesta, will see a crowd of 14 equally matched low-goal teams slugging it out for the Silver Cup between February 13 and 18.
Tournament Manager, Olumayowa Ogunnusi , commended the main sponsor GTCO and other sponsors for their immense support over the years, stating that the Lagos Polo Club looks forward to delivering great values for the sponsors and participants players, invited special guests and polo buffs during the epoch fiesta.
Glittering subsidiary prizes to be won include, the Oba of Lagos, Adedapo Ojora Memorial Cup, Sani Dangote Memorial Cup, the Italian Ambassador’s Cup and the Independence Cup, Lagos He and Chief of Naval Cup, among others are also on offer during the fiesta reputed as the oldest polo tournament in the country.
Representative of the main sponsor, GTCO, said the sponsorship of the 2024 NPA Lagos International Polo Tournament, which has grown over the years to become one of the most anticipated social and sporting events, ‘ is a demonstration of the bank’s strong belief in the role of sports in developing and uniting the society’.
